Ricciardo and Rosberg avoid penalties for red flag practice infringements

Daniel Ricciardo and Nico Rosberg have both avoided penalties after the pair were found to have overtaken cars under the red flags during opening practice ahead of the British Grand Prix. Free practice one was red-flagged following Felipe Massa’s crash at the exit of Stowe early in the session. Under red flag conditions drivers are not permitted to overtake rival cars. However, Rosberg – the fastest man in opening practice – was seen to pass Daniil Kvyat’s Toro Rosso, while Red Bull’s Daniel Ricciardo overtook Fernando Alonso.
